148
149 void
150 print_help_and_exit ()
151 {
152 printf (
153 "Usage: %s [OPTIONS] FILE...\n\
154 Tell the Emacs server to visit the specified files.\n\
155 Every FILE can be either just a FILENAME or [+LINE[:COLUMN]] FILENAME.\n\
156 \n\
157 The following OPTIONS are accepted:\n\
158 -V, --version Just print a version info and return\n\
159 -H, --help Print this usage information message\n\
160 -n, --no-wait Don't wait for the server to return\n\
161 -e, --eval Evaluate the FILE arguments as ELisp expressions\n\
162 -d, --display=DISPLAY Visit the file in the given display\n\
163 -s, --socket-name=FILENAME\n\
164 Set the filename of the UNIX socket for communication\n\
165 -a, --alternate-editor=EDITOR\n\
166 Editor to fallback to if the server is not running\n\
167 \n\
168 Report bugs to bug-gnu-emacs@gnu.org.\n", progname);
169 exit (0);

171
172 /* In NAME, insert a & before each &, each space, each newline, and
173 any initial -. Change spaces to underscores, too, so that the
174 return value never contains a space. */
175
176 void
177 quote_file_name (name, stream)
178 char *name;
179 FILE *stream;
180 {
181 char *copy = (char *) malloc (strlen (name) * 2 + 1);
182 char *p, *q;
183
184 p = name;
185 q = copy;
186 while (*p)
187 {
188 if (*p == ' ')
189 {
190 *q++ = '&';
191 *q++ = '_';
192 p++;
193 }
194 else if (*p == '\n')
195 {
196 *q++ = '&';
197 *q++ = 'n';
198 p++;
199 }
200 else
201 {
202 if (*p == '&' || (*p == '-' && p == name))
203 *q++ = '&';
204 *q++ = *p++;
205 }
206 }
207 *q++ = 0;
208
209 fprintf (stream, copy);
210
211 free (copy);

275 extern int errno;
276
277 /* Three possibilities:
278 2 - can't be `stat'ed (sets errno)
279 1 - isn't owned by us
280 0 - success: none of the above */
281
282 static int
283 socket_status (socket_name)
284 char *socket_name;
285 {
286 struct stat statbfr;
287
288 if (stat (socket_name, &statbfr) == -1)
289 return 2;
290
291 if (statbfr.st_uid != geteuid ())
292 return 1;
293
294 return 0;
